5 Documentaries On Netflix You Should Watch

1. Malaysia 370: The Plane that Vanished

Stars on Netflix ~ 2

Found In: Documentaries, Historical Documentaries

Why you should watch it: It's a well written and well produced documentary on the even that shocked the world. It provides a variety of insights into the disappearance of the Malaysian airline and uses evidence--some of it new--in ways that most viewers have never heard before. You learn about the disappearance of this specific plane, as well as the physics and technologies involved in modern-day flying mechanisms.

2. Cosmos: A Spacetime Odyssey

Stars on Netflix ~ 5

Found In: TV Shows, TV Documentaries, Science & Technology TV Documentaries

Why you should watch it: Absolutely fascinating. It's literally one of the most well written shows I've ever seen and presents rather esoteric information in a way that is not only easy to understand but remarkably interesting. Also, it's a series of episodes, so you can take breaks in between to grasp the information you just received in addition to always having something to look forward to when each section is over.

3. Intervention Collection

Stars on Netflix ~ 4

Found in: TV Shows, TV Documentaries, Reality TV

Why you should watch it: If you can handle the occasionally graphic nature, this series is really interesting. It's fascinating and so upsetting to see how addiction can tear families apart at the seams, but the episodes often end on a happy and hopeful note.

4. The Truth Behind: The Bermuda Triangle

Stars on Netflix ~ 2

Found In: TV Shows, British TV Shows, TV Documentaries

Why you should watch it: There may be more documentaries on the Bermuda Triangle than on most other geographical areas of the world, but for good reason. It's riveting. Each documentary, like this one, tends to recount a story you hadn't previously heard, and present new information that came along with the latest technology. Also, this one in particular gives a good variety of disasters and events (plane related, boat related, supernatural related, etc.) so there's no risk for boredom.

5. Planet Earth: The Complete Collection

Stars on Netflix ~ 4.5

Found In: TV Shows, British TV Shows, Science & Nature TV

Why you should watch it: Every single frame is captivating, giving you a new view of the parts of the world you'd always wished you could see. This series gives you a sense of the enormity of our planet, and how precious all of the species that live on it are. Not to mention the fact that it's won four Emmys and is described as "inspiring" and "feel-good".
